Passan: Red Sox have the top-two trade chips in baseball, led by Bregman

A Red Sox season that opened with so much promise has left a lot to be desired.

Entering Tuesday’s game against the Angels, the Red Sox sit at 40-40 and have just a 25.6 percent chance of making the playoffs, according to FanGraphs.

Even though the Red Sox have already dealt their top slugger in Rafael Devers, Boston could continue to sell off assets before MLB’s trade deadline, especially if the team opts to shift its focus toward letting younger players like Roman Anthony and Marcelo Mayer develop.

If Boston decides to sell, Craig Breslow should have no shortage of suitors lining up, given the number of veteran players who could help other teams for the stretch run in 2025.
